Ticket: Per-tenant rate quotas ignored on staging-east

Priority: High

The Quotaline service on staging-east is applying the global default quota to every tenant instead of per-tenant limits. Root cause: the environment was provisioned from the old Ferncastle template, which omits the quota-store connection settings, so the service silently falls back to defaults. The fix is to restore the missing block in the env file. The quota store rejects anonymous connections, so the entry immediately below supplies the credential it needs.

sealed setting: ARCHIVE_KEY3=8d0

# Pick-list optimizer constants — Cratewise plugin API
#
# This module drives route scoring for the Cratewise warehouse pick-list
# optimizer. Plugin authors may read these constants but must not mutate
# them at runtime; the scheduler snapshots them at batch start. Scores
# combine aisle distance, bin height penalty, and cart capacity slack.
# If your plugin supplies a custom cost function, it is blended with the
# default using the weights defined here. The current tuning constants
# are as follows.

tuning constants:
QUOTAS = {
    "druwyn": 5,
    "holix": 5,
    "zorath": 5,
    "holwyn": 10,
}

### Changed defaults: Stormcall fan-out

Quick heads-up for the sync: we bumped the Stormcall fan-out defaults after last Tuesday's squall of duplicate alerts. Batch size is smaller now and the retry backoff is less aggressive, so downstream consumers in the Lakeshore region shouldn't get hammered. If you run a local Stormcall instance, pull the new defaults before testing. Here's what ships out of the box now.

deployment values, kajep-kageg:
[praix]
host = praix.paliqcorp.corp
user = praix_svc
database = praix_prod

### Step 4: Migrate the Locker Access Flow

New folks: the Suds & Stow laundry-locker access flow moves from PIN codes to rotating tokens in this release. Run the `locker_tokens` migration first; it backfills a token for every active locker in the `lockers` table. Old PINs remain valid for a 14-day grace window, tracked by the `pin_expiry` column. Verify the backfill count matches the active locker count before flipping the flag. For the staging database, connect using the string below.

replica DSN, kajep-yahag: mssql://praok_svc:iF@db-8d68.plorvaio.local:5432/eliion